Output 642eabce23c5a4f18f1309301f36d4e95de6f19e3b9042dba62a0b3de999e1eb:0

value
3867077597
script pubkey
OP_0 OP_PUSHBYTES_20 514debc18d036987d66a6a45d88a0d97545c3edb
address
tb1q29x7hsvdqd5c04n2dfza3zsdja29c0km60asmg
transaction
642eabce23c5a4f18f1309301f36d4e95de6f19e3b9042dba62a0b3de999e1eb